Why are Online Travel Agents Important?

The position of an online travel agent, or OTA in short, has become increasingly relevant within the hotel industry as it provides travelers with a simple way to compare hotels and book them online, from the convenience of their own home or on the go. They are important because:

  • OTAs make your travel company more clear. The OTAs provide the small tour operators with a forum to become accessible to a wider audience and locations. Via the sensitive and configured website, travel agents can promote their goods internationally, and enter the wider audience.
  • OTA provides tremendous flexibility and choices, allowing consumers to compare related goods and select the easiest one. For examples, if tourists are looking for accommodation then they first look for price, room types available, amenities and room interior and reviews etc.
  • OTAs deliver transparency in real time, something that only reached the streets due to amazing technical advancements. Travelers may choose when to book a tour and come up with a destination or experience that suits their itinerary. This could mean booking a last minute a night before, or an hour before. Travelers can even request a reservation during the normal operating hours of 9 to 5, which ensures that tour operators tend to produce revenue even while they are sleeping.
  • Not all passengers are carrying a laptop or have access to a device when driving, but they have a mobile or tablet. Most OTAs are designed for mobile apps, allowing travelers to book and even pay from their small screens for a tour. What's more, the bulk of tours offered on OTAs don't need a paper ticket, making it convenient for travelers to just turn up and enjoy it.
  • OTAs do, unlike traditional tour and activity companies who do not always have huge budgets or resources to sell their goods. In reality, selling their site and merchandise is in their favor, as they only make money when you sell a tour.
  • Big OTAs also have other travelers 'comments and feedback included, an significant consideration in the decision-making process. Much like how you create TripAdvisor on positive and honest feedback, so are your tours. It is through these reviews that your buyers get a fair view of the company and can make an educated decision on the purchase.
  • In the end, OTAs provide you with direct access to a wide number of future buyers. Possible advantages of using an online travel agent to market your business include: Listing your property and its rooms is a low cost way. Reductions of spending spent on the internet ads. To attract new foreign buyers OTAs should invest in marketing and advertising. Costs in can a domain. OTAs are keen to provide the consumers with a positive online experience by good website design and accessibility. Online travel sites are popular with travelers who want to compare the cost of lodging with the facilities that individual providers provide.
